Some of the most common reasons people need garage door repair in Granger, Indiana are listed here:
Garage Door Won't Open or Close
A garage door that won't open or close might be caused by a variety of different problems including broken springs and cables, broken or poorly of aligned sensors, or a broken garage door opener. Garage Door Banging Noise
Banging noises are frequently caused by misaligned doors. It's important to get this problem fixed sooner rather than later to prevent other damage from taking place.
Weather Stripping Repair
As your garage door gets older, the weather stripping or trim may deteriorate and need repair. Replacing the weather stripping will help insulate your garage and keep undesirable wildlife outside.
Rattling Garage Door Noises
Rattling sounds may be caused by loose nuts or bolts, dry parts needing to be lubricated , misaligned doors, or a garage door opener that was not properly put in.
Garage Door Scraping Sounds
Scraping noises are frequently the result of misaligned doors.
Squeaking Garage Door
Squeaking sounds could be caused from a loose roller or hinge, parts needing oiling, or misaligned doors.
Rubbing Noise Garage Door
Rubbing could be caused by bent tracks or a jammed or tight track which needs fixing.
Grinding Sound Garage Door
Grinding noises may be caused by parts needing lubrication, loose rollers or hinges, a stripped garage door opener gear, or an improperly hung opener.
Slapping Garage Door Noise
Slapping sounds are sometimes caused by a loose chain.
Vibrating Garage Door Noise
Vibrating noises are sometimes caused by loose parts or rollers needing lubrication.
Popping Noise Garage Door
Popping sounds could be caused by torsion spring problems.

Garage Door Opener Installation
The median life of a garage door opener is approximately 10-15 years. Routine maintenance, oiling, and taking care to be sure your garage door is balanced will aid in extending the life of your opener. For safety and security reasons, if you own a garage door opener which was produced before 1993, it’s recommended to have it replaced instead of repaired. New Garage Doors
When you have done multiple repairs or maintenance on your garage door, if it’s still not functioning correctly, then it may be time to contemplate replacing the garage door . New doors have a broad range of benefits, one of which is improving the curb appeal of your property and increasing home values and providing better security and safeguards. Brand new garage doors contain the most up to date safety and security requirements to keep your family and property safe. New doors also give more insulation and may help regulate the temperature of your home's interior and also make the garage space more comfortable.
